The Central Statistics Office (CSO) recruiting for an Assistant Principal, Data Office in their Cork Office.

The successful candidate will assist and report to the Principal Officer for Enforcement Legal and Governance and the position is based at the CSO’s Cork Office.

The closing date is on Tuesday 24th May 2022.

The new position of Assistant Principal, Data Office will work in a team of six, comprising one other Assistant Principal, two Higher Executive Officers and two Executive Officers, reporting to the Principal Officer for Enforcement Legal and Governance. The creation of this new position represents a significant corporate investment for the CSO and stands as evidence of the commitment of the organisation to excellence in data governance, not just to acting in compliance with the relevant legislation but in striving to maintain CSO at the cutting edge of excellence in this area.

Key duties & responsibilities

The AP Data Office role involves a wide range of functions, including:

  • Advising on and being responsible for design, implementation and compliance in relation to data governance, data protection and GDPR policies, practices and procedures within the CSO
  • Managing the provision of supports across the Office in relation to a range of data governance processes, including but not limited to Data Protection Impact Assessments (DPIA), Data Necessity and Proportionality Assessments (DNPA) and Transparency Notices
  • Data Subject Access Requests (DSARs) management
  • Data Breach management
  • Representing the Office on working groups, both internal and external, as required
  • Continuous overview, update and promotion of the Data Management Policy, and ensuring compliance with same
  • Managing the development and delivery of data governance/data protection training
  • Processing requests under the Freedom of Information Act, 2014 within regulatory deadlines
  • Supporting the administration of the Office’s Confidentiality & Data Security Committee (CDSC) which is responsible for coordinating the implementation of our obligations relating to statistical confidentiality and data security
  • Data Office Helpdesk management
  • Leading the Data Office team
  • Fostering and maintaining effective relationships with key stakeholders, both internal and external
  • Supporting the Head of Division, the Data Protection Officer (DPO) and the Management Board in building and pro-actively developing a high performance, innovative and responsive organisation
  • Any other additional responsibilities as allocated from time to time.
